The Francis Schaeffer Study Center (FSSC) is a homeschool tutorial program designed to equip high school students, including 10th graders, with a robust, Christ-centered education. Its curriculum emphasizes an integrated study of Western Civilization, combining history, literature, art history, and Bible studies to foster critical thinking and a biblical worldview.
For 10th-grade students, FSSC continues its chronological exploration of Western Civilization, focusing on the development of ideas and cultural movements. Classes are led by dedicated tutors who begin sessions with prayer and encourage active participation through discussions and questions, creating an engaging and supportive learning environment

Beyond her professional accomplishments, Cyndy and her husband have homeschooled all of their children through grade 12. Since 1996, she has been actively involved in various homeschool tutorial programs.
In 2004, she and her husband, Rob Shearer, established the Francis Schaeffer Study Center which offers a Christ-centered, integrated humanities education for homeschooling high school students. Their commitment to fostering a biblical worldview and critical thinking skills has made FSSC a respected resource within the homeschooling community.
